The link above is to photos I did of Body Fur and a resulting minnow pattern submitted recently for Brad Robinson's Minnow Swap. It should give you some idea of what this material is like and how it can be used.
The only two sources I know of currently for SAAP body fur and wing fiber are the Fly Fishing Shop in Welches, Oregon (http://www.flyfishusa.com) and the Dan Bailey online catalog (https://www.dan-bailey.com/via5/index.jsp - click on Fly Tying Tools & Materials and then Synthetic Wings and Tails). Only Bailey has the winging fiber described by Mark. Quantity of material supplied in each package is generous and the price is $3.50 for the Body Fur and $2.95 for the Wing Fiber.
